Pedestrian controlled tractors (single axle tractors) — Import in Bosnia and Herzegovina
Bosnia and Herzegovina: Pedestrian controlled tractors (single axle tractors) — Import was 350 No in 2009. ▼ Falling
Pedestrian controlled tractors (single axle tractors) — Import in Bosnia and Herzegovina, 2003–2009
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in No.
Analysis
In 2009, pedestrian controlled tractors (single axle tractors) — import in Bosnia and Herzegovina stood at 350 No. That is the lowest value across all 7 years on record.
That represents a change of down 84.7% on the previous year and down 77.1% over ten years.
That places Bosnia and Herzegovina 40th out of 95 countries with data for 2009, putting it in the middle of the range.
Pedestrian controlled tractors (single axle tractors) — Import in Bosnia and Herzegovina, year by year
| Year | No |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2003 | 1,530 No | — |
| 2004 | 1,954 No | +27.7% |
| 2005 | 1,192 No | -39.0% |
| 2006 | 810 No | -32.0% |
| 2007 | 810 No | +0.0% |
| 2008 | 2,283 No | +181.9% |
| 2009 | 350 No | -84.7% |

About this data
Important notice: FAOSTAT database on Agriculture Machinery is no longer active. The latest online version of the database has as reference year 2009 (with data collected in year 2011). FAOSTAT database on Agriculture Machinery provides statistical series on Agricultural Machinery and Equipment statistical series referring to the following items: tractors, harvesters and threshers, irrigation pumps, milking machines, hand tools, and soil machines. The database includes estimates of agriculture machinery in use and value of import and export of agriculture machinery.
